Susquehanna 70, Stockton 57

The Stockton women’s basketball team returned from a one-week layoff with a 70-57 loss to Susquehanna in a non-conference road game.  Lisa Neira (Cresskill/Cresskill) shot 9-13 from the field and scored a game-high 19 points.  Kelley Guarrera (Shamong/Shawnee) added 14 points and Jenn Russell (Scotch Plains/SP-Fanwood) finished with 10 points and five assists.  The Ospreys were hampered by 25 turnovers and out-rebounded 32-20 in the game.
 
Stockton scored just nine points in the first 15 minutes and trailed 18-9.  Neira sank a jumper to spark a 6-0 run that pulled the Ospreys within 18-15, but Susquehanna established a 27-21 lead at the break.  Neira led all players with 10 first-half points on 5-6 shooting.
 
In the second half, Ashley Hart (Pt. Pleasant Beach/Peddie School) drained a free throw and Guarrera followed with a bucket to give Stockton a 42-39 lead with 9:33 to play.  Susquehanna then reeled off 12 consecutive points for a 51-42 advantage with 5:51 on the clock.  Guarrera finally ended Stockton’s four-minute draught with a basket to pull the Ospreys within seven, but they could get no closer as Susquehanna pulled away late and won 70-57.
